Whispers in the Wings: A Sibling’s Revival

On the fringes of a town almost forgotten?buried under years of memories and whispers?stood the Clover Theater, its façade sagging like an old storyteller pausing to recall a past glory. It was here that Lila, a reclusive artist renowned for capturing vibrant landscapes, and Owen, a compassionate playwright with dreams in ink and paper, had spent childhood summers. And it was here that Sybil, a spirited dancer with a laugh like a babbling brook, had concocted grand schemes and imagined adventures.

However, time had spun its web between Lila and Owen, casting them adrift from each other after a bitter family disagreement. Sybil, ever wistful for their sunlit days together, had watched from the sidelines, waiting for a moment to weave them back into the same tapestry. When the old theater’s dusty doors creaked open announcing a revival performance, she knew the time had come.

One evening, Sybil gathered her friends on the theater?s stage, where once they had played and dreamt. “We must bring this theater back to life,” she declared, her energy infectious and her intent unwavering. “And you two,” her finger pointed playfully between Lila and Owen, “we?ll weave your artistry into the very fabric of its revival.”

Though hesitant at first, Lila agreed, her mind imagining vibrant set pieces that could echo her brush strokes. Owen felt his heart stir at the thought of writing a new play, one that could illuminate the shadows hidden behind the theater’s curtains.

With tools in hand and echoes of laughter guiding them, the trio set to work restoring the Clover Theater. Yet, as they scrubbed away layers of dust, whispers?both metaphorical and spectral?began to creep into the theatre halls.

Objects misplaced themselves, scripts vanished only to reappear dog-eared with strange annotations, and the stage lights flickered with mischievous intent. “It seems this place has its fair share of ghostly residents.” Owen quipped, attempting humor amidst his own unease.

“Perhaps they simply yearn for a good performance,” Sybil jested, her twirl around the stage dispelling shadows as easily as breath dispels fog.

The theater?s mysteries proved to be less daunting than the strained silence between Lila and Owen. It was Sybil’s fervent belief that art had the power to heal and reconnect even the most tangled of ties. As they delved into the theater’s restoration, their shared laughter began to chip away at the icy wall standing between them.

In one poignant evening beneath a canvas of stars, Lila turned to Owen, her voice breaking the silence, “I?ve missed this. Us.”

Owen, with his heart quietly nodding in agreement, let the words fill the empty space between them, “I?ve missed it too.” Their shared bond, though tattered, was not beyond mending.

The revival night arrived, unveiling not just a newly vibrant theater, but also a rediscovered bond. As the curtain rose to reveal Lila’s majestic set designs and Owen’s heartfelt play, a gentle wind stirred through the audience. Whispers of approval and soft laughter danced through the theater, a testament to the ghostly witnesses satisfied after years of silence.

With applause echoing through the newly awakened halls, Sybil took center stage beneath the spotlight. “Tonight,” she stated, casting a glance toward her friends, “we honor the theater’s legacy and the beauty of coming home to each other.”

The Clover Theater had returned to its former glory, its chatoyant past sculpted by the hands of those who had once wandered far, only to find themselves standing at home once more. And as Lila and Owen looked out into the vibrant glow of the audience, they discovered that sometimes true art wasn’t what they created, but what was mended along the way.
